The biannual search for a new San Diego Padres manager is underway and already we’re hearing some familiar names being kicked around. Some of them make a lot of sense. Others are simply being mentioned because of organizational familiarity or convenience.

For example, Scott Servais is already with the organization as a special assistant in player development and Ryan Flaherty was with the club as a bench coach, interviewing for the job two years ago before Mike Shildt got it. Both are certainly viable options but come with serious question marks.
